Transaction 6553068894ff87a7409e5978c87167ab6bcd853a5728fb36895652244c058f96
1 Input
1 Output
-
6553068894ff87a7409e5978c87167ab6bcd853a5728fb36895652244c058f96:0
- value
- 18528
- script pubkey
- OP_0 OP_PUSHBYTES_32 548ca137c48e3f12c9e3e30b52cc27d6c46fe2ccd0ca19e908657c684beae533
- address
- bc1q2jx2zd7y3cl39j0ruv949np86mzxlckv6r9pn6ggv47xsjl2u5es6jdps0